Buyer’s guide before choosing the laptop for deep learning
Graphics processing unit:
The first and foremost feature which we need to consider before buying the best laptop for deep learning is GPU. The graphic processing unit of any laptop determines its visuals quality, display functions, and representations.
Having a robust performant GPU is vital for machine learning laptops because in deep learning matrix multiplications are performed which includes heavy images and videos and a high-performing GPU helps in parallel processing of the matrices.
So always choose a laptop with a good GPU if you want it for your deep learning practices. You can choose any good graphics card among the NVIDIA GeForce series or RTX 20 series. Although you can also consider AMD Radeon if you have a restrictive budget.
RAM:
For conducting convolutional and deep neural networks which are involved in deep learning processes it is advisable to buy a laptop with at least 16 GB RAM.although laptop with a 32 GB RAM will be more appreciable for running heavy software but RAM less than 16 GB won’t be compatible with the machine learning laptops prerequisites.
CPU:
The performance and efficiency of any laptop are measured by its CPU type, count, and frequency rate.
For deep learning laptops, the CPU should be powerful enough to cope up with the system lags and hitches efficiently and able to run complicated matrix multiplications seamlessly.
I will suggest you buy a laptop for machine learning with at least core i7,quad-core, and 7th generation. Although processors with more cores and high type will be more favorable to run heavy applications.
Storage:
A spacious storage option is much needed for storing or running heavy computational data required during deep learning projects.so I will recommend you buy a laptop with a 1TB hard disk option which is more than enough for storing extensive data set. As a minimal option, you can also go for 512GB SSD but less than this will not be able to give a competent outcome.
Portability:
As a deep learning professional or a practitioner, you may need to go to different conferences, simulation sites, or offices with your machine learning devices. So in such circumstances, I will prefer to buy a machine with a relative portability ratio but keep in mind that portability and processing power are in a converse relationship if you choose an ultra-sleek or portable laptop you may have to compromise on its processing power.so make a choice wisely among portability and processing power.
